Holte Town Hall, Arne Jacobsen Architect, Denmark
The Søllerød Town Hall, completed in 1942, was designed in the Functionalist style by Arne Jacobsen and Flemming Lassen. Søllerød Council is situated approximately 20 kilometers north of Copenhagen, where the town of Holte is home to one of a number of Arne Jacobsen (1902-71) designed town halls (1938-42).
Ørestad Copenhagen New Town Architecture
West Amager and Ørestad, also known as Copenhagen S, is built around nature, water and architecture. Since the development in Ørestad started in 1995 many families and students have moved into the many, architect-designed buildings.
